Read more...Aug 21, 2021· Iron Ore: Owing to strong demand from China, Malaysia's main iron-ore export destination, and with higher prices, output during the year increased by 17.8 per cent to 1,914,232 tonnes from 1,625,253 tonnes in 2015. They were produced from 41 mines located in Pahang, Johore, Perak, Kelantan, Kedah and Terengganu.

Read more...Mineral extraction/mining industry history including jasper, limestone, iron ore Jasper Mining and quarrying have been important activities in the Macungie area for many hundreds of years. The first rock to be extracted from the ground to be used by humans was jasper, which the Lenape Indians used for their tools and weapons.

Read more...Of the iron ore exported 38.5% of the volume was iron ore pellets with a value of $2.3 billion and 61.5% was iron ore concentrates with a value of $2.3 billion. Forty-six per cent of Canada's iron ore comes from the Iron Ore Company of Canada mine, in Labrador City, Newfoundland, with secondary sources including, the Mary River Mine, Nunavut.

Read more...In Wisconsin, the most important iron ore minerals are oxides: magnetite (Fe 3 O 4), hematite (Fe 2 O 3), and goethite/limonite (Fe 2 O 3 •H 2 O). Brief overview of Wisconsin's iron mining history. Limited amounts of high-grade iron ore were first mined in Wisconsin in the 1850s in the Black River Falls District of Jackson County and the ...

Read more...Sep 23, 2019· The extraction of iron from its ore is the third and the penultimate process in metallurgy, which is the process of separating metals from their ores. The common ores of iron are iron oxides. These oxides can be reduced to iron by heating them with carbon in the form of coke. Heating coal in the absence of air produces coke.
